The vibrant streetwear culture in Korea is making waves globally, combining modern trends with cultural elements. From oversized silhouettes to striking accessories, Korean street fashion sets itself apart with its daring and fresh aesthetic.
An essential characteristic of Korean urban style is the popularity of loose fits. Relaxed sweatpants, voluminous blazers, and loose-fitting tees are staples in many outfits, balancing laid-back appeal with high-fashion elements. Fashion enthusiasts use contrasting fits for a dynamic look, creating effortlessly stylish outfits.
Another standout trend in Korean street fashion is layered outfits that add depth and texture. Vibrant shades and daring prints are everywhere in Korean streetwear. Fluorescent oranges, vivid teals, and bold patterns are commonly seen in statement pieces. Checkerboard patterns, abstract prints, and floral motifs bring energy to the outfits, allowing for a harmonious look.
Footwear is a vital component of Korean street fashion. Retro trainers, sleek loafers, and edgy boots are must-have items, providing a perfect blend of style and practicality.
Accessories are equally important in Korean street fashion. Patterned socks, bold handbags, and quirky hats complete the look, helping create truly individualized styles.
The essence of Korean street style lies in self-expression and bold choices. With its growing global influence, its clear that Korean street fashion is here to stay.
